There's a time and a place for everything. Imagine a live version of the Cornelius Brothers And Sister Rose hit "Too Late To Turn Back Now" without strings. You either have to be creative and do a reggae version of the song, get a decent keyboard player to do it right, or sound like a moron for attempting a live version of a song you know you're only going to butcher thereby ruining everyone's night out. That's the right place for a backing track. Being too lazy to learn the set list isn't the place.
